What has Freddie Prinze Jr. been up to lately? In Mass Effect 3, he did the voicework for James Vega, an alliance marine. The character is also the center of Mass Effect: Paragon Lost, an animated film that takes place before ME3. The Bluray/DVD combo is available from Amazon and you can also watch it through Xbox Live.



Mass Effect: Paragon Lost, prequel to the best-selling Mass Effect 3, follows the early career of Alliance Marine, James Vega (Freddie Prinze Jr.) as he leads an elite Special Forces squad into battle against a mysterious alien threat known as the Collectors. Stationed at a colony in a remote star system, Vega and his troops must protect the colonists from the alien invaders bent on abducting humans for unknown purposes. Outmanned and outgunned, Vega must rally his squad to defend the colony at all costs... even if it means making the ultimate sacrifice.
